## Further reading

Before touching the Larkspur broker upgrade, please read the background material carefully — this cluster carries every order event for the Pemberline platform, and a botched rolling restart in the past cost us six hours of replay. The docs cover version compatibility between Larkspur 3 and 4, the queue-draining procedure, and how consumer offsets are preserved during the cutover. As a new contractor, start with the architecture overview, then the upgrade checklist. Both are maintained on the internal page here.

runbook for tahop-hahof: https://confluence.ferranet.internal/display

### Step 3: Point Doclinter at the shared rules store

Heads up, plugin authors: as of Quillcheck 2.0, lint rules no longer live in your plugin manifest. They're fetched from the central rules database at startup, so your old `rules.yml` can be deleted once you've migrated. Your plugin just needs read access during its init hook. Use the connection string below to reach the shared rules store.

warehouse DSN: mssql://rusdor_svc:0FSWCn9@db-951a.paliqforge.local:5432/ulawyn

**Q: How do I book the wellness room at Fernleigh Court?**

Easy — grab a slot on the Quietspace calendar in the staff portal, max one hour a day so everyone gets a turn. The room's on Level 4 past the kitchenette; please wipe down the mats after use and keep phones on silent. The door locks automatically, so once your booking starts, let yourself in with the code below.

turnstile pass: bdg-QZV-3